How to prepare for a job interview at Wayman Learning Trust

✨Know Your Physics Inside Out

Make sure you brush up on key physics concepts and recent developments in the field. Be prepared to discuss how you would make these topics engaging for students, as this will show your passion and creativity.

✨Showcase Your Teaching Style

Think about how you can demonstrate your teaching methods during the interview. Prepare a mini-lesson or an example of an engaging activity you would use in the classroom to inspire students at KS4 and 5 level.

✨Connect with the School's Values

Research the school’s culture and values before the interview. Be ready to explain how your teaching philosophy aligns with their commitment to academic excellence and personal growth, showing that you’re a great fit for their community.

✨Ask Thoughtful Questions

Prepare some insightful questions to ask the interviewers about their teaching environment and professional development opportunities. This not only shows your interest but also helps you gauge if the school is the right place for you.
